8. Fluidized Bed Reactor – HZI FBR Capacity
Types of Waste
• Sewage Sludge (biosolids), Industrial sludges
• 50 – 80% moisture
Range of Capacity
• Throughput: 10 – 120 dtpd (biosolids)
• Thermal Capacity: 5 – 175 MMBtu/h (1.5 - 50 MW)
• Reactor Sizes: 4 – 30 feet (1 – 10 m) diameter
Features
• Combustion Temperature: 1560 ºF (850 ºC)
• No heat absorption in reactor
(good for combustion of very wet fuels)

DeNOx Systems
Main Features
SNCR
Injection of ammonia water or urea solution
into post combustion chamber
With or without ammonia recovery
Reaches NOx removal up to 80%
SCR
Catalysts for NOx-removal and dioxin
reduction
Arrangement on hot (235°-260°C) or cool
(180°- 220°C) side of flue gas scrubbing
Reaches NOx removal up to 90%
Capacity
Flue gas volume up to 150,000 scfm
(250,000N m3/h)

12. Metropolitan Council Environmental
Services | St. Paul, MN
Page12
Three independent lines supplying one steam turbine
generating 4 MWe
No auxiliary fuel required during normal operation
Combined heat and power production
Emissions surpass MACT requirements for SSI
Hitachi Zosen Inova, EPC contractor for incinerator/boiler,
flue gas treatment, and generator
Client Metropolitan Council
Environmental Services,
St. Paul, MN
Start-up 2004
Technology
Furnace 3 Incinerator Lines
Energy recovery Recuperators, Boilers
Flue gas treatment SNCR, carbon injection, fabric filter,
wet-ESP, wet scrubber heat exchangers
Technical Data
Fuel Municipal sewage sludge
Waste capacity 315 dry t/d @ 30% solids
Net calorific value 2,000 Btu/lb wet
Reactor Diameter 22 feet
Steam rate 3 x 25,000 pph (450 psi, 750 °F )
Key Data
